Abstract

A medical procedure for positioning an embolic protection device effectively prevents material from entering with blood flow into side branch vessels of the aortic arch. The protection unit is permanently attached to a transvascular delivery unit at a connection point at a support frame that is at least partly arranged at a periphery of a selectively permeable unit. In an expanded state of the device, the connection point is enclosed by the support member or arranged at said support member.

Claims (33)

1. A collapsible embolic protection device for transvascular delivery to an aortic arch, said protection device comprising:

a delivery unit and

a protection unit comprising a selectively permeable material, a support frame, and a connection point configured for attachment to said delivery unit;

wherein:

said protection unit has a collapsed delivery state and an expanded state;

a perimeter of said support frame, in the expanded state of said protection unit, is shaped to releasably engage with vessel tissue of the aortic arch around the ostia of three side branch vessels such that said selectively permeable material covers said three of side branch vessel ostia;

said selectively permeable material is attached to or is integral with said support frame and allows blood to pass into said three side branch vessels but prevents embolic material in the blood from entering said three side branch vessels; and

said connection point arranged on said perimeter of said support frame at a proximal end thereof;

wherein said protection unit and said delivery unit are configured to be permanently connected at said connection point; and

wherein at a distal end of said protection unit, said support frame is shaped as a tongue forming an extension of the protection unit, and wherein the width of said tongue is narrower than the width of said distal end of said protection unit; whereby said tongue is configured to facilitate collapsing of said protective unit into its collapsed delivery state.

2. The device of claim 1 , wherein said support frame and said delivery unit comprise a wire.

3. The device of claim 2 , wherein said wire is bent at an angle such that the protection unit is arranged at said angle with the delivery unit in a longitudinal direction of said device.

4. The device of claim 3 , wherein said delivery unit is configured to be oriented toward the ostia of said three side branch vessels.

5. The device of claim 1 wherein, in the expanded state of the protection unit, a portion of the support frame is bent at an angle with respect to said perimeter of the support frame to form a stem of said support frame that extends at said angle from said perimeter.

6. The device of claim 5 , wherein said support frame comprises a wire forming the perimeter of said support frame and said stem comprises two branches of said wire that are joined at said connection point.

7. The device of claim 5 , wherein said connection point is positioned on said stem at a distance from said perimeter of said support frame.
